The Pony Express

Text Article  on  Interior Page(s)
Credits
?
typeset
Subject Matter
informational, non-fiction, western
Harry Roff; Alex Carlyle; Pony Bob Haslam; Buffalo Bill Cody
The Pony Express was organized...
Reprinting
 
Miscellaneous
2
B-484
The history of the Pony Express covered in two pages of text, with two nice illustrations, previously credited to 'Charles J. Strong?', but the face in the second one reveals Pete Morisi's style.
